The Admissions Jury: Composition and Role

The admissions jury is composed of a jury president (representing Grenoble Ecole de Management) and one or two members from the business world.

Your Role as a Jury Member

As a jury member, you take part in evaluating candidates for GEM’s Grande École Program. Your role is to assess their motivation, personality, and ability to express themselves and interact. 
You’re Not Alone!
Each session is led by a GEM jury president who guides you throughout the interviews.
 

Please note: all interviews are conducted in French. Fluency in French is required.

 

How a Jury Session Works

Each half-day jury session includes the evaluation of 5 to 6 candidates. The format is structured and consistent for all:

  • Candidate presentation (5 min): a free presentation on a topic of their choice.
  • Reverse interview (10 min): the candidate asks you questions.
  • Open discussion (15 min): a free exchange to go deeper.

⏱️ Total duration: approx. 30 minutes per candidate.


Required presence: one half-day (morning or afternoon)
Morning jury*: 8:15 AM to 12:30 PM
Afternoon jury*: 1:15 PM to 6:30 PM

In-Person or Remote Participation

You can take part:

  • In Grenoble (main campus).
  • In Paris (GEM Paris Pantin campus).
  • Remotely via Microsoft Teams (GMT+1 Paris time).

Support and preparation

  • You’ll receive jury guidelines before your session.
  • A jury president will be present to support you.
  • A GEM team is available for any logistical questions.
  • An on-site briefing and discussion with the jury president is scheduled before interviews.
  • A FAQ is available on the website.

 

Tips for a great experience

  • Be attentive, kind, and curious.
  • Ask open-ended questions.
  • Let the candidate express themselves freely.
  • Share your impressions at the end of the interview (no scoring required).
